Where to find the biggest orphenadrine discounts

Prices for orphenadrine (often sold as orphenadrine citrate or orphenadrine ER in tablet form) vary mainly by:
- Which strength and formulation you need (for example, ER vs. immediate-release)
- Your pharmacy (independent vs. chain vs. online)
- Whether you use a manufacturer coupon, a discount card, or cash pricing

To compare real-world options quickly, check discount pricing tools and pharmacy listings, then compare the same dose/formulation across pharmacies.

Are discount cards or coupons better than cash price?

Often, the best price changes by location and date. In general:
- Cash prices can be lower at some pharmacies for common generics.
- Pharmacy discount cards (third-party or pharmacy-specific) can beat standard insurance copays when you have no coverage or a high deductible.
- Manufacturer coupons usually apply only in limited situations (more often for brand-name products), so they may not help if your product is generic.

What if you have insurance—can the “discount” still apply?

If you use insurance, your cost is typically the copay or coinsurance based on the plan. Discount cards generally can’t stack with insurance in most cases. The cheaper route is usually whichever of these is lower:
- Your insurance copay/coinsurance
- The cash price (or cash price with a discount card)
